Key concepts and overview
Casino bonuses are promotional offers provided by online casinos to entice new players and reward existing ones. These bonuses can take various forms, including welcome bonuses, no deposit bonuses, free spins, and loyalty rewards. Understanding these core concepts is vital for industry analysts as they assess the competitive landscape and consumer preferences. Each type of bonus serves a specific purpose, and their effectiveness can vary based on the target audience and marketing strategies employed by the casinos.
- Welcome Bonuses: Typically offered to new players upon registration, these bonuses can double or triple the initial deposit, providing a significant incentive to start playing.
- No Deposit Bonuses: These allow players to try out the casino without making a financial commitment, often in the form of free credits or spins.
- Free Spins: Often tied to specific slot games, free spins allow players to win real money without risking their own funds.
- Loyalty Rewards: Designed to retain existing players, these bonuses reward frequent play with points that can be redeemed for cash or other perks.
Main features and details
The mechanics of casino bonuses involve several key components that determine their attractiveness and usability. Firstly, the terms and conditions associated with each bonus are critical. These conditions outline the wagering requirements, which specify how many times a player must wager the bonus amount before they can withdraw any winnings. Additionally, the validity period of the bonus, the eligible games, and the maximum cashout limits are also essential factors that players must consider.
- Wagering Requirements: These are often exp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ount. For example, a 30x wagering requirement on a $100 bonus means the player must wager $3,000 before cashing out.
- Game Restrictions: Not all games contribute equally towards meeting wagering requ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ute less.
- Expiration Dates: Bonuses usually have a limited time frame within which they must be used, adding urgency to the player’s decision-making process.
Practical examples and use cases
To illustrate how casino bonuses work in practice, consider a new player who signs up at an online casino offering a 100% welcome bonus up to $200. Upon depositing $200, the player receives an additional $200 in bonus funds, giving them a total of $400 to play with. However, with a wagering requirement of 30x, the player must wager $6,000 before they can withdraw any winnings. This scenario highlights the importance of understanding the terms associated with bonuses, as they can significantly impact the player’s experience and potential profitability.
Another example involves a seasoned player who regularly participates in a loyalty program. As they accumulate points through their gameplay, they may receive exclusive bonuses, such as free spins on new game releases or cashback offers on losses. These loyalty rewards not only enhance the player’s experience but also encourage continued engagement with the casino.
Advantages and disadvantages
Casino bonuses come with both advantages and disadvantages that industry analysts must consider. On the positive side, bonuses can attract new players and enhance player retention, leading to increased revenue for casinos. They also provide players with opportunities to explore new games without financial risk. However, the complexity of terms and conditions can lead to player frustration and dissatisfaction if not clearly communicated.
- Advantages:
- Increased player acquisition and retention.
- Enhanced gaming experience through additional funds and opportunities.
- Disadvantages:
- Potential for player confusion regarding terms and conditions.
- Risk of players becoming overly reliant on bonuses, leading to unsustainable gambling habits.
